Contemporary valve adjustment on these AMC-design Jeep® inline engines is performed by choosing the correct length pushrods. This presentation addresses the fundamental design and valvetrain mechanisms of these engines. Traditional valve adjustment methods described have been superseded by selecting the right pushrods by length. An inexpensive CompCams or similar pushrod length checking tool is used for this procedure.

This exchange applies to 232, 258, 4.0L and 2.5L engines. There are several other discussions. Always check and choose the right length pushrods after cylinder head surfacing, block decking, a camshaft change or a complete engine rebuild.
